Drew Eubanks (born February 1, 1997) is an American professional basketball player for the Utah Jazz in the NBA. A versatile center/power forward, Eubanks is known for his strong defensive presence, shot-blocking ability, and energy on the boards. Standing 6’9″, he played college basketball at Oregon State, where he averaged 13.2 points and 6.8 rebounds per game. Undrafted in 2018, Eubanks worked his way up through a two-way contract with the San Antonio Spurs, eventually earning a regular roster spot. His hustle, rim protection, and efficient shooting make him a valuable rotation player in the league.
